Beschreibung

There is a secret organization that cultivates teenage spies. The agents are called Love Interests because getting close to people destined for great power means getting valuable secrets.

Caden is a Nice: The boy next door, sculpted to physical perfection. Dylan is a Bad: The brooding, dark-souled guy, and dangerously handsome. The girl they are competing for is important to the organization, and each boy will pursue her. Will she choose a Nice or the Bad?

Both Caden and Dylan are living in the outside world for the first time. They are well-trained and at the top of their games. They have to be – whoever the girl doesn’t choose will die.

What the boys don’t expect are feelings that are outside of their training. Feelings that could kill them both.

The Love Interest by Cale Dietrich is a gay YA thriller that is non-stop action from start to finish.

Gute Unterhaltung, aber kein perfektes Buch

Ich bin sehr schnell durch dieses Buch gekommen, da es einen angenehmen Schreibstil hat und sehr spannend ist. Das dystopische Setting sorgt dafür, dass einem eine grundlegende Angst vermittelt wird und man ständig rätselt, wie der Konflikt am Ende wohl aufgelöst wird. Es gibt jedoch einige Kritikpunkte, die ich anbringen möchte: - einige Entscheidungen der Charaktere waren sehr überraschend und dadurch etwas unschlüssig - einige Szenen und Handlungsstränge sind nicht ganz logisch schlüssig - bei mir sind einige Fragen bis zum Ende offen geblieben Das klingt allerdings schlimmer als es ist, denn darüber lässt sich hinweg sehen, wenn man will. Die Spannung, die Beziehung der Charaktere und das Setting des Buches sind es definitiv wert!

This book features two boys both challenged with making a girl fall in love with him instead of the other at peril of death. It does not ask the question of what type of society would put teenagers in this terrible position. For example, the main character is forced to watch a video of a robot strangling the life out of a boy his age, showing him what will happen if he doesn't win. There is no thought of, "I better run and call the police." Police or authorities who care don't seem to be around/exist. This world is a cold place where they throw teenagers in an incinerator if they get out of line. You just have to accept that and move on with the story. The two boys, one a Nice boy, and one who is a Bad boy, approach getting the girl's love from opposite perspectives. Jump ahead to this part of the story, the two boys alone:"I brought you here to kiss you" "Are you joking?" ... "I'm going to kiss Juliet tomorrow. And I need practice. ... I thought we could kiss each other like teenage girls do in sitcoms to prepare for the real thing." They are supposed to be enemies, because only one of them can live. But, the Bad boy is really nice. He likes to share his feelings with the Nice boy, and take him on long drives at night. He knocks on the Nice boy's bedroom window most every night, saying he needs friendship and someone to talk to who understands the truth of the situation they are in. The Bad boy is the one who wants to do the kissing. The Bad boy's warm openness is the only "good" thing in the world of this story. Just like the Nice boy does, I began to look forward to the parts of the story where the Bad boy appeared.
